Transaction 25629410cbac7cb44402149f96cc505960498db0e66a95718d188bbbc59eaee9
1 Input
1 Output
-
25629410cbac7cb44402149f96cc505960498db0e66a95718d188bbbc59eaee9:0
- value
- 24806741
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a3bb8f6275d741191916c35579f1a24a61a77b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mWYnhYpaUciSEKuKyvkhgQyLdZUHu2fh